Diclofenac

Active ingredientDiclofenac sodium
Mechanism of actionNon-selective inhibition of cyclooxygenase (COX-1 and COX-2) enzymes, reducing prostaglandin synthesis.
Common doseTypically 50 mg-100 mg orally 2-3 times daily, adjusted for indication and patient response.
What is it used for?Pain, inflammation, and fever associated with conditions such as os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, acute musculoskeletal injuries, and postoperative pain.
Important information on takingTake with food or milk to reduce gastrointestinal irritation; do not exceed prescribed duration; maintain consistent dosing intervals.
Common side effectsGastrointestinal upset, nausea, headache, dizziness, and mild skin rash.
Serious risksCardiovascular events (e.g., myocardial infarction, stroke), severe gastrointestinal bleeding, renal impairment, and hepatic dysfunction.
InteractionsIncreased risk when combined with other NSAIDs, anticoagulants/antiplatelets, ACE inhibitors, diuretics, lithium, methotrexate, and certain antihypertensives.
ContraindicationsActive peptic ulcer disease, severe heart failure, recent coronary artery bypass graft, severe renal or hepatic impairment, and known hypersensitivity to diclofenac or other NSAIDs.
Legal statusPrescription-only medication in most jurisdictions; classified as a controlled substance only in limited contexts.

Understanding Diclofenac and its purpose

How Diclofenac works in the body: definition and pharmacological action

Diclofenac is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ug used to relieve pain and inflammation. It works by inhibiting enzymes that produce prostaglandins, molecules that mediate fever, swelling, and discomfort. By reducing prostaglandin levels the medication lowers body temperature and decreases the response of inflamed tissues to injury. This action helps alleviate conditions such as arthritis musculoskeletal pain and postoperative swelling. The active compound Diclofenac is absorbed into the bloodstream and travels to sites of inflammation where it blocks the cyclooxygenase pathways. Blocking these pathways interrupts the signaling cascade that recruits immune cells and increases blood flow to damaged areas. As a result the drug decreases the synthesis of inflammatory mediators and modulates the activity of cells that amplify pain signals. Overall Diclofenac provides systemic relief of symptoms by targeting the biochemical processes that underlie pain and tissue response.

Pharmacological characteristics of Diclofenac

Diclofenac is a nonsteroidal antiinflammatory drug used to relieve pain and inflammation. It is commonly prescribed for conditions such as arthritis and acute musculoskeletal injuries. The medication works by selectively inhibiting the cyclooxygenase enzymes cox1 and cox2 in the body. This inhibition reduces the synthesis of prostaglandins, which are chemical mediators that promote pain and swelling. By decreasing prostaglandin levels, Diclofenac diminishes the sensation of discomfort and the response of inflamed tissues. Its pharmacokinetic profile includes rapid absorption after oral administration and distribution throughout various tissues. The drug undergoes hepatic metabolism and is eliminated primarily by the kidneys, influencing its duration of action. Overall, Diclofenac provides effective analgesia and antiinflammatory effects through targeted modulation of inflammatory pathways.

Common reactions Diclofenac can cause

Side effects of Diclofenac

Diclofenac can cause gastrointestinal discomfort including nausea and heartburn. It may increase the risk of cardiovascular events such as heart attack or stroke. Some users experience headaches or dizziness. Skin reactions like rash or itching can occur. Elevated liver enzymes are possible leading to mild liver dysfunction. Rarely bleeding from the gastrointestinal tract may happen. The medication can affect kidney function especially in people with pre-existing conditions. Joint pain may improve but the drug does not cure underlying joint damage.
